[JRuby] Porter une application Rails en JRuby
Bonjour à tous ,
j'essaie actuellement de porter mon application ruby vers jruby afin d'utiliser la jvm :)
Après un peu de recherche, j'ai trouvé plusieurs site qui expliquait comment procéder
J'ai donc installer jruby, modifier les fichiers environment.rb et database.yml
Puis viens le moment de créer le fichier .war pour pouvoir le mettre dans le répertoire de tomcat. C'est ici qu'arrive mon problème:
en essayant à l'aide de warber, un certain nombre de fichier est copier dans le répertoire tmp\war puis j'ai une erreur (et surtout pas de fichier .war)
Citation:
rake aborted!
You have a nil object when you didn't expect it!
You might have expected an instance of Array.
The error occurred while evaluating nil.split
C:/jruby-1.2.0/lib/ruby/gems/1.8/gems/rake-0.8.4/lib/rake/
repaired_system.rb:109
:in `find_runnable'
(See full trace by running task with --trace)
Je ne sais pas quoi faire ?
J'ai aussi essayer en installant le plug-in Goldspike mais impossible de l'installer
et si je relance la commande :
bien sur la création du war m'est impossible
Code:
1 2 3 4 5 6 7
|
C:\jrails_apps\EPFWiki>jruby -S rake create_war
(in C:/jrails_apps/EPFWiki)
rake aborted!
Don't know how to build task 'create_war'
(See full trace by running task with --trace) |
Merci de votre aide